Commonly Asked Questions

Can I use something besides gnocchi?

Yes! You can substitute any pasta for the gnocchi.

What if I do not have vegan feta?

Any type of cheese will work for this meal, but feta is preferred for a mediterranean feel.

Can I air fry the gnocchi?

Yes! It is best to follow the cooking directions on the packaging, but most gnocchi can be cooked in an air fryer.

Extra Helpful Tips

If you are cooking the lentils, do this ahead of time to save time.

Make a double batch of the dressing to use on salads and meals throughout the week.

Mediterranean Gnocchi

Your usual Mediterranean salad just got an upgrade! This Mediterranean Gnocchi dish is both filling and nutritious and has a delicious dressing to go with it. This gnocchi dish makes the perfect lunch, dinner, or meal to bring to a group gathering and is totally dairy-free and vegan!
serving 4 people
prep time 35 minutes
cook time 10 minutes
total time 45 minutes

the ingredients

  • 16 oz gnocchi
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 cup halved cherry tomatoes
  • 3 cloves minced garlic
  • 1 diced zucchini
  • 1 diced red onion
  • 1 diced red bell pepper
  • 1 14 oz can brown lentils rinsed and drained
  • 1/2 cup vegan feta
  • 1/4 cup sliced kalamata olives
  • 1/4 cup sliced sun-dried tomatoes

Dressing

  • 3 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 tbsp red wine vinegar
  • 2 tbsp chopped fresh parsley
  • 1/4 tsp garlic powder or 1 tsp fresh
  • 2 tbsp hummus
  • 1 tsp dried oregano
  • Salt + pepper to taste

instructions

  • In a pan, saute minced garlic, zucchini, red onion, garlic, red bell pepper in olive oil until tender.
  • While veggies cook, pan fry gnocchi in a pan until golden brown (I use Trader Joe’s cauliflower gnocchi).
  • Whisk dressing ingredients in a bowl.
  • Assemble everything in a bowl including cooked gnocchi, lentils, sautéed veggies, feta, olives, sun dried tomatoes, and the dressing.
  • Gently toss and combine. Enjoy!
  • Store in the fridge for 2-3 days.
